On 02/23/18 at 12:42pm, Tyler Baicar wrote:
> If ESRT initialization fails due to an unsupported version, the
> early_memremap allocation is never unmapped. This will cause an
> early ioremap leak. So, make sure to unmap the memory allocation
> before returning from efi_esrt_init().
